The basic aim of psychoanalytic therapy is to undo the unresolved conflicts that are the cause of the neurosis. During therapy we attempt to study these phenomena from five basic theoretical points of view: topographical, dynamic, economic, genetic, and structural. Even the best technique requires a goodly amount of time to overcome the formidable tyranny of the neurotic patient’s past and his compulsion to repeat. (68 pp)
